IMPACT x Nightline: Diddy on Trial is Hulu’s latest hard-hitting documentary special, diving into the controversial legal battle surrounding music mogul Sean “Diddy” Combs. This exposé brings together investigative journalism, exclusive interviews, and expert commentary to explore the allegations and cultural implications of one of the entertainment industry’s most high-profile trials. Produced by Hulu in collaboration with ABC News Studios, the production is currently in the spotlight and may seek contributors and background participants for upcoming episodes and expansions of the series.
Production Details:
-
Director & Host: Byron Pitts
-
Featured Analysts: Eboni K. Williams, Lisa Bloom
-
Production Companies: Hulu, ABC News Studios
-
Filming Locations: New York, Los Angeles, and Atlanta
-
Current Status: Streaming Now, Additional Content in Development
What We Know So Far:
The special offers a deep dive into the federal charges against Sean “Diddy” Combs, including sex trafficking, racketeering, and conspiracy. Diddy on Trial gives voice to survivors, legal experts, and insiders from the hip-hop industry, including exclusive conversations with longtime associates like Charlucci Finney. The episode sheds light on the broader implications of power, fame, and accountability in the music world, while exploring the intersection of celebrity and the justice system.
Given the cultural resonance and ongoing developments surrounding this case, Hulu may continue expanding its coverage. Future episodes or follow-up specials could require additional reenactments, expert interviews, and background talent.
